When Lady Abigail approaches James Wright all she wants is for him to tell her about what takes place between a man and a woman in the marriage bed. Her younger sister is getting married and being 25 and unmarried herself she isn't in a position to give that advice. James, the illegitimate son of a nobleman, agrees to teach her but finds himself attracted to her. Things soon become more physical and both James and Abigail find themselves falling in love. The problem is that Abigail is a Lady and if her relationship with James becomes common knowledge she'll lose everything. I've read some of Cheryl Holt's books before and always enjoyed them.
